Thank you for posting this-I am sorry that your instrument cluster was replaced for naught-Its pretty sad Ford knew of this problem a few years ago and fixed it under warranty-they knew the connector was made inferior and moisture,water and oil got inside the connector and made the cluster go haywire- these cars sometimes wouldnt start when the moisture got in the connector-so after warranty is over- pay up at the dealer even though they know its a manufacturing defect-my neighbors car was doing this-I was able to correct it for him-all I did was take screws out of door to replace oil filter- open it- the 4 pin connector is close by- its in front of oil filter taped to another wire on the bottom radiator support-I unplugged it water dripped out of it-I blew air through it from compressor(both ends of the plug)-got hair dryer-heated both plugs to dry out completely-reconnected plug everything works as it should-this car had low miles- it took 7 years for moisture to get inside and cause a problem-so changing the connector wasnt done here
